Patiala Administration Issues Safety Advisory Amid Rising Ghaggar Water Levels

Patiala (Gurpreet Singh): The Patiala District Administration has issued an alert for villages situated along the Ghaggar River, after continuous rainfall in the catchment areas pushed water levels higher at Bhankharpur. Authorities have urged residents to exercise caution and avoid venturing near the riverbanks.

According to an advisory released by SDM Rajpura, Avikesh Gupta, precautionary measures are especially advised for villagers in Untsar, Nanheri, Sanjarpur, Lachhru, Kamalpur, Rampur, Saunta, Maru and Chamaru.

Residents can contact the flood control room in Rajpura at 01762-224132 for assistance or updates.

In Dudhan Sadhan, SDM Kirpalveer Singh has cautioned people from Bhasmra and Jalahkhedi Raju Khedi to remain alert. Similarly, SDM Patiala, Harjot Kaur Mavi, has advised communities in Hadana, Pur, and Sirkappara to stay vigilant.

The administration has also provided emergency helpline numbers 0175-2350550 and 0175-2358550 for reporting unusual water levels or emergencies. Citizens have been urged not only to follow safety instructions but also to avoid spreading or believing in unverified information that may cause panic.

Officials stressed that these measures are precautionary, aiming to ensure the safety of residents as the monsoon continues to impact the region.
